SASCOC responds to Netball SA president’s shock allegations

Posted on October 21, 2025
72

The South African Sports Confederation, Olympic and Paralympic Committee (SASCOC) has strongly denied allegations made by Netball South Africa President Cecilia Molokwane, who claimed the organisation was involved in her suspension from World Netball.

Molokwane, speaking during a media briefing, suggested that SASCOC, in collaboration with individuals within Netball South Africa, had orchestrated a campaign to tarnish her reputation – a claim SASCOC now categorically refutes.

‘Does not interfere’

In an official statement, SASCOC said it “respects the autonomy of international sporting bodies” and “does not interfere in their disciplinary processes.”

The body confirmed it had not received any formal complaint or evidence from Molokwane to support her claims.

“Public allegations made without substantiation risk undermining the integrity of our sporting institutions,” the statement read, adding that issues of this nature should be handled through appropriate and formal channels.

‘Transparency’

Cecilia Molokwane was recently suspended by World Netball under circumstances yet to be fully disclosed.

She maintains her innocence and has hinted at internal politics playing a role in the sanction.

SASCOC concluded its response by reaffirming its commitment to transparency, accountability, and fair governance in sport.

There has been no official comment yet from World Netball regarding Molokwane’s allegations or the specific reasons for her suspension.
